Brandon Adams wrote:
| I woild assume that you would configure / build a new kernel for each
| hardware spec in your farm in your test environment, verify there are
| no glitches and then distibute the .config file to all servers and
| cron a kernel build / installation.

I'd say that depends on your idea of kernel building.
We prefer a general kernel with static drivers for crucial
hardware/option and module drivers for non-crucial hardware/options

Combined with module autoloading this allows for a flexible system with
little overhead.

I know that there are several people in the security community that
advertise disabling module-loading, however consider the problems you're
in if someone is actually able to load modules on one of your servers.

| The reboot required for the servers would then be done during that
| server's maintenance window.

We're currently researching if we can reduce the maintenance down-time
for kernel reloading by using kexec. On large memory servers and
scsi/raid controllers bios re-initialization can easily take up to 10
minutes. (that's pre-bootloader)
